    Upwork: Your Freelance Gateway

    Next, let's talk about Upwork. Upwork is a huge online platform where freelancers can find work and clients can find freelancers. Whether you're a writer, a designer, a developer, or a financial consultant, Upwork can provide access to a global market of opportunities. One of the great things about Upwork is its flexibility. You can set your own rates, choose your own hours, and work from anywhere with an internet connection. Sounds great, right? That is why Upwork is one of the most popular platforms for freelance work. However, there is a catch. The competition is fierce. The most successful freelancers on Upwork are those who know how to stand out. This means creating a strong profile, showcasing your best work, and actively bidding on jobs. Building a strong profile is your first step. It is crucial to craft a profile that accurately reflects your skills, experience, and the services you offer. Be sure to include a professional headshot, a compelling summary, and a detailed list of your skills. Don't be shy about showing off your accomplishments. Also, it is important to build a portfolio. If you have examples of your past work, make sure to include it. When you are applying for jobs, you should write a compelling proposal. When you are bidding on jobs, it is not enough to simply send a generic proposal. You need to tailor your proposal to each specific job. Take the time to understand the client's needs and show how your skills and experience align. When it comes to finance, there's a strong demand for freelancers with expertise in areas like accounting, financial analysis, and tax preparation. The key is to position yourself as a problem-solver and to demonstrate your value to potential clients. Also be sure to research the client. Before you start communicating, take the time to research the client. This will enable you to tailor your proposal and show that you understand their needs. By taking these steps, you'll greatly improve your chances of securing freelance gigs. Upwork can be an invaluable resource, especially if you have an entrepreneurial spirit.

    Decoding NSC (NSCSC) and Its Financial Implications

    Now, let's discuss NSC. NSC typically stands for National Savings Certificate. It's a savings bond issued by the Indian government. The aim is to encourage small to medium income investors to invest, while also helping the government with its national projects. Depending on where you live, the exact terms and conditions of an NSC may vary. However, generally, an NSC offers a fixed interest rate and a guaranteed return. It is often considered a low-risk investment option, making it suitable for risk-averse investors. The money invested is generally locked in for a specific term, and the interest earned is compounded annually. In some cases, the interest earned can be reinvested. The interest income is taxable, but the investment itself may qualify for certain tax deductions under specific sections of the Income Tax Act. NSC investments are considered safe. The reason is because they are backed by the government. The NSC scheme is a relatively safe investment option, especially when compared to market-linked investments like stocks or mutual funds. Keep in mind that the returns are usually lower. Compared to other investment options, the returns from NSC are often lower. However, this is the trade-off for the lower risk. You can use this as a component of your overall financial strategy. NSCs can be a useful component of a diversified investment portfolio. They can provide a stable stream of income and help you reach your financial goals. However, it's essential to understand the terms and conditions. Before investing in NSC, it is important to understand the terms and conditions, including the interest rate, the tenure, and the tax implications. It's also a great way to save money and ensure that your money is safe and secure. The key is to weigh the pros and cons. The value of NSC can be dependent on your financial circumstances. For some investors, NSC may be the perfect fit, whereas for others, there may be better investment options available. It is important to know your options and pick the one that fits your needs.

    Finance: Navigating the Financial Landscape

    Okay, let's talk about Finance. Finance is a broad term, but in this context, we're focusing on personal finance, investment, and how they relate to the other topics. Financial literacy is crucial for everyone. Understanding how money works, how to budget, save, and invest is essential for building a secure financial future. This is especially true for freelancers on Upwork who need to manage their income and plan for their financial goals. For those of you who are working on Upwork, it's particularly important to have financial discipline, especially since income can fluctuate. This means setting up a budget, tracking your expenses, and saving a portion of your income. The key is to identify your needs, and then create a budget that helps you achieve your goals. This is where financial planning comes in. Financial planning involves setting financial goals, creating a plan to achieve those goals, and then monitoring your progress. This may include saving for retirement, buying a home, or paying off debt. One important aspect is understanding investment options. Stocks, bonds, mutual funds, and real estate are just some of the investment options available. Each comes with its own set of risks and rewards. It is best to do your homework and understand how different investment vehicles work. Financial planning, financial literacy, and the importance of financial discipline is crucial for everyone, especially those working on Upwork.
